Technical Considerations for Print-on-Demand Success
For those new to the print-on-demand space, file format selection is critical. When you are setting up a new product listing, the platform usually asks for a transparent background PNG or a high-resolution JPEG.
Because this package includes SVG and EPS files, you have a massive advantage if you need to edit the design. Perhaps you want to change the color scheme to match a specific brand guideline, or maybe you want to isolate a single element—like a pumpkin or a bat—to use as a standalone icon for a logo design. Vector files allow you to do this in software like Adobe Illustrator or Affinity Designer without degrading the image quality.
However, always keep readability in mind. If you are placing this design on a busy background or a textured fabric (like a heather grey sweater), ensure the contrast is high enough. A common mistake is placing dark design elements on dark apparel, causing the details to get lost. Test your mockups rigorously before publishing.
